Output 508fac25d903d42ea69ec1786556429dd9f720f878e96dd1b88fa2878d95939a:0

value
10204251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cbf7fa99eeb719656bcc2bb504a39ea1a34bc3b OP_EQUAL
address
3MpDzJpof7FZRTTE134THHft5umCk6aGpp
transaction
508fac25d903d42ea69ec1786556429dd9f720f878e96dd1b88fa2878d95939a
spent
true